Exactly How Cold Laser Treatment Works



To understand exactly how cold laser therapy functions, picture a focused light beam of low-level lasers connecting with your body's tissues to stimulate healing at the mobile level. These low-level lasers produce a particular wavelength of light that penetrates the skin without triggering any kind of damages.

When this light energy reaches the targeted cells, it's soaked up and launches a series of biological reactions. One vital mechanism behind cold laser treatment is that it boosts mobile power production. The light power is exchanged biochemical power, which advertises increased ATP manufacturing. ATP, or adenosine triphosphate, is vital for mobile function and plays an essential duty in mobile repair service and regeneration.

Additionally, cold laser treatment can also help in reducing swelling and pain. By boosting the release of endorphins, which are all-natural pain relievers produced by the body, it can offer relief from pain. In addition, the treatment can enhance blood circulation, causing far better oxygen and nutrient distribution to the cells, better sustaining the healing procedure.

Applications of Cold Laser Treatment



One of the primary uses of cold laser treatment is in the treatment of sports injuries. Professional athletes typically turn to cold laser treatment to assist increase the healing process of soft cells injuries like strains, strains, and tendonitis. The non-invasive nature of cold laser therapy makes it an eye-catching choice for athletes aiming to get back to their peak performance quickly.

Apart from sporting activities injuries, cold laser treatment is additionally commonly utilized in pain monitoring. It can help minimize chronic pain problems such as arthritis, fibromyalgia, and lower neck and back pain. By targeting specific locations of pain, cold laser treatment promotes mobile repair work and lowers inflammation, giving alleviation for those dealing with consistent discomfort.

Moreover, cold laser treatment has actually located applications in dermatology for injury healing and mark reduction. The low-level laser light advertises tissue regeneration, collagen manufacturing, and improved blood flow, which can help in the healing of injuries and reduce scarring.
